It happened last Tuesday, April 19, inside of a McDonald's located at 181-25 Hillside Avenue in Flushing, Queens.
According to police, the suspect entered the restaurant at some point that night and hid in the bathroom. When the restaurant closed, the suspect then exited the bathroom wearing a mask and produced a black semi-automatic handgun. He forced two of the three workers into the freezer and the remaining worker to the safe. After gaining access to the safe, the suspect then removed money and flex cuffed the remaining worker.
The suspect then took off on Avon Street, police said. He is described as a black man, approximately 28 to 33 years old, standing 6-feet tall and weighing about 200 pounds. He has long black hair and was last seen wearing a black ski mask, blue hooded sweatshirt and blue pants.
